Abstract
After an activation of the CPU in a peripheral device in a computer system, a determination is made whether an external power supply input or operation of a software switch is inputted as a trigger. Based on this determination, the peripheral device is left ON or turned OFF so as to be in the same state as when power was last removed. When it is not necessary to supply the power to the peripheral device, the power to the CPU is turned OFF to reduce power consumption.

1. A power controller for a peripheral device in a computer system, the power controller comprising:
-
a peripheral device nonvolatile memory storing data indicating an ON/OFF state of the peripheral device when power was last removed from the computer system;
a peripheral device power supply; and
